Naval Air Systems Command (NAVAIR) intends to issue a sole source acquisition pursued under the authority of 10 U.S.C. 2304(c)(1) and FAR 6.302-1, "Only One Responsible Source and No Other Type of Supplies or Services will Satisfy Agency Requirements." The firm fixed price contract modification to Insitu, Inc., Bingen, WA, will be for a 6 month extension of services for the United States Marine Corp (USMC) to prevent a break in service of critical Unmanned Aerial Services (UAS) Intelligence, Surveillance, and Reconnaissance (ISR) requirements in support of Operation Enduring Freedom (OEF). Insitu, Inc. is the only firm which can fulfill the mission critical requirements due to having the Level III flight clearance approval and the Authority to Operation (ATO) within the area of operations (AOR). The follow-on to this effort has been competitively selected. The purpose of this acquisition is to provide for the continuation of services while the follow-on vendor obtains necessary operational clearances. Accordingly, Insitu, Inc. is the only firm with the unique knowledge, experience, and approved operational clearances to provide the required service during the interium period.
